Awesome – so before we get into the rest of our questions, can you briefly introduce yourself to our readers.
Since I was a little girl, I’ve been captivated by the world of advertising and communication, leading me to pursue a career in marketing. I began my journey in esteemed consumer and service powerhouses like Procter and Gamble, Coca-Cola, and BBVA. My focus was always on market research, trends, and identifying business opportunities based on meeting consumer needs. Simultaneously, I embarked on a meditation practice during my teenage years, driven by a curiosity for life beyond the mundane. This dual passion for marketing and mindfulness eventually led me to found RIMA Strategy and Marketing, with a mission to help growth-stage companies succeed. We provide Fractional C-Level services. Unlike traditional consulting, we immerse ourselves in our clients’ teams, providing top-level executive services on a part-time basis. Our hands-on approach allows us to not only identify solutions but also implement them alongside our clients.
However, it’s not just about numbers for us. We also prioritize the human perspective, fostering relationships that promote team alignment and positive industry impact.
The evolving landscape, including the rise of artificial intelligence and shifts in global geopolitics, has opened new doors for us. As a Mexican American, I’m particularly excited about the opportunities presented by Mexico’s emergence as the largest trade partner of the US. Mexico offers numerous advantages, including geographic proximity, a skilled workforce, and government incentives, making it an ideal market for US businesses.
At RIMA, we’re also passionate about helping US companies navigate these opportunities in Mexico while ensuring mutual benefit for all involved. In today’s rapidly changing world, adaptation is key to maintaining competitiveness, and we’re dedicated to finding innovative solutions that serve everyone involved.
Can you share a story from your journey that illustrates your resilience?
During a time when I was genuinely content in my business and personal life, I encountered a remarkable spiritual teacher speaking about how everything that happens can bring us closer to living a more fulfilling life. I remember thinking, ‘One day, I’ll apply this knowledge and see if it is true.’ That day arrived when my marriage fell apart, resulting in a sudden divorce that brought immense sadness, fear, and earthly challenges into my life. I recalled the words of that teacher and set out to understand their essence. How could I channel those overwhelming emotions and real challenges for good and continue with my business with all those feelings and two boys? I sought out the teachings of Mickey Singer, traveling to his place in Florida. His wisdom helped me navigate forward, not driven by my emotions as I had previously thought, but despite them. Even though I had a solid business background, I suddenly felt vulnerable and needed to dedicate much more time to my children. My practices shifted focus to practicality—how to be present and use my life skills in this new setting.
Confronting intense emotions and difficult circumstances allowed me to explore deeper and develop a newfound empathy for those experiencing loss and disorientation. Life seemed to guide me to work closely with various wise mentors at different parts of my path. My meditation journey extended beyond yoga in earlier years, working with Thomas Keating in centering prayer in Colorado for many years, reconnecting with my Mexican roots and its mysticism through Don Miguel Ruiz, author of ‘The Four Agreements’ later on, and finally, Mickey Singer, author of The Untethered Soul, whose spiritual yogic practices applied to business, enriched my understanding of life experiences.
This journey led to a commitment to well-being paired with a pragmatic economic perspective, applying well-being practices to every facet of life—from family and connections to success in business. At the time, I was teaching practical principles of mindfulness. My teaching expanded, erasing divisions across different life domains. Whether mentoring middle-aged women re-entering the job market or guiding business leaders seeking fulfillment beyond success, assisting young adults navigating career decisions, or simply aiding individuals in finding more authentic joy, I deeply appreciate mentoring, teaching, and supporting my students and peers.
Whether through the classes I teach, organizing larger events, or assisting everyday business clients and mentees, I cherish the opportunity to share practical insights into well-being and business.
